What does a box truck driver do?

A Box Truck Driver is responsible for transporting goods, materials, or merchandise using a box truck, which is a medium-sized, enclosed vehicle. Their duties typically include loading and unloading cargo, ensuring safe delivery to the designated location, and maintaining accurate delivery records. Box Truck Drivers often work for delivery companies, retailers, or logistics firms, and may be required to follow specific routes or schedules. They must also adhere to traffic laws and safety regulations while operating the vehicle. Additionally, basic vehicle maintenance and customer service may be part of the job.

What are some common challenges a box truck driver might face on the job, and how can they be managed?

Box Truck Drivers often encounter challenges such as navigating congested urban areas, managing tight delivery schedules, and ensuring the secure loading and unloading of cargo. To overcome these obstacles, drivers should familiarize themselves with efficient route planning tools, maintain clear communication with dispatchers and clients, and follow proper safety protocols for handling goods. Staying organized and proactive can help minimize delays and ensure smooth daily operations.

A DAY IN THE LIFE OF A MOVER / BOX TRUCK DRIVER

As a Mover / Box Truck Driver, you are responsible for completing household moves in a timely manner for our clients. With our team, you provide a world-class customer service experience by greeting customers upon arrival, preparing items to be moved, loading or unloading trucks, and carefully handling each item. You coordinate with job site leads to ensure efficiency. In the driving position, you carefully transport items to the new site. Some of your other duties include inspecting trucks, performing inventory, collecting payments, and accurately completing paperwork. You feel good about helping our customers and enjoy working with such a fun and supportive team!
